Imbsen & Associates, Inc. (IAI) is a structural engineering firm with a broad spectrum of capabilities, including the special expertise to analyze and solve unusual and difficult structural problems. IAI was founded in July 1986 by Dr. Roy A. Imbsen, the former president of Engineering Computer Corporation. Staffed by skilled and dedicated professionals, IAI offers unique experience in bridge design, applied research, earthquake engineering, and advanced computer technology. An experienced design staff, together with computer aided drafting, enables IAI to produce plans, specifications and cost estimates (PS&E) for varying types of bridge projects, ranging from new bridges to widening, strengthening and retrofitting existing bridges. Since 1995, Merrick has delivered Airborne GPS (ABGPS) services to control photogrammetric mapping projects. The ABGPS team provides all flight planning, ground-to-aircraft support, equipment, and personnel required to develop the ideal analytical aerotriangulation solution that meets client accuracy requirements. Highly precise and cost-effective, this advanced technology is supported by Merrick's comprehensive and fully integrated land information capabilities. With experience in both field and ABGPS methodologies, Merrick bases its approach on the client's needed result.

RICHMOND, VA , TBE Group, a subsurface utility engineering (SUE), utility coordination and right-of-way services consulting and engineering firm, received the Federal Highway Administration's (FHWA) prestigious 2007 Excellence in Utility Relocation and Accommodation Award. The award recognizes TBE's participation on the Maryland State Highway Administration's (MSHA) Intercounty Connector project. TBE provided utility coordination services on the project. Joseph Bissett, Senior Utility Coordinator on the project, accepted the award on behalf of TBE's Richmond, Virginia, office. The FHWA developed the biennial awards program to honor those who excel in improving utility relocation and accommodation practices. The award was presented at the 2007 American Association of State Highway and Transportation Officials (AASHTO) Right of Way and Utilities Subcommittee Conference in Orlando, Florida, on April 30, 2007. The award, presented for the category of Incentives for Utility Relocation/Projects Over $100 Million, recognized the MSHA and its consultants, including TBE, for providing innovative incentives enabling 15 utility companies to relocate approximately $40 million of complex overhead and underground utilities as part of five design-build projects for the construction of the Intercounty Connector highway. TBE was also honored with FHWA Awards of Excellence for work performed on projects in Georgia and Florida. Michael Baker Corporation provides engineering and energy services to public and private sector clients worldwide through its operating subsidiaries. The Company is a provider of outsourced operations and maintenance services to the energy industry in the Gulf of Mexico. The Company operates through two segments: Engineering and Energy. The Company’s Engineering segment provides a variety of design and related consulting services, principally in the United States. The Energy segment provides a range of services to operating energy production facilities worldwide. Contracts with various branches of the United States government accounted for 27% of its total contract revenues for the year ended December 31, 2007. The Company’s contracts with the Federal Emergency Management Agency (FEMA) accounted for approximately 14% of its revenues in 2007. (Source: 10-K)

Balfour Beatty plc is an engineering, construction and services company. The Company has a 100% interest in four PFI/PPP concessions through its shareholdings in Connect Roads Sunderland Holdings Ltd, Connect Roads South Tyneside Holdings Ltd, Connect Roads Derby Holdings Ltd and Transform Schools (Knowsley) Holdings Ltd. It operates in Hong Kong and Dubai. The Company has four segments Building, building management and services; Civil and specialist engineering and services; Rail engineering and services; Investments, and Corporate. In April 2007, it acquired Centex Construction. In August 2007, it acquired Cowlin Group. In October 2007, it acquired Covion Ltd. In March 2008, the Company acquired Dean & Dyball Limited. In June 2008, Heery International, the Company’s United States professional and technical services arm, acquired Douglas E Barnhart Inc. In June 2008, the Company acquired Schreck-Mieves GmbH, the German rail engineering group.
